Hello. I am writing this message because there are going to be some
changes in the roles of the es-ES team. I am no longer going to be the
owner of any of the products, neither the team-owner.

The team-owner is going to be Ricardo Palomares Martinez. Actually,
regarding his contributions, he has always been the team-owner, but I
suppose I was initially named as that because I was the first one to
obtain CVS access.

Firefox owner is going to be now Guillermo López Leal, but he hasn't
acquired yet a CVS account AFAIK.

I could just write these changes in the mozilla wiki (at the l10n teams
section), but I wanted to know if I should do anything else to vouch for
them.

I have been very glad contributing in these Mozilla projects. Many
thanks to all for your support.

Hi Andres et al,

thanks for posting.

Guillermo, first of all, a welcome from the folks here. It'd be
interesting to me to get some additional details on you, like technical
skills and platforms you're working on. Might actually be useful
information across the board.

As for Andres, do you want to stay as peer? That'd probably be a good idea.

I have no problems with you just adjusting the owners wiki page, though
that is not a general opening. For team changes like this, giving me a
heads up notice is a good idea. Doing so in the newsgroup has the
additional benefit that the community can follow those things.

If you have more questions, send them my way.
